Zero Budget Natural Farming (100% organic farming)
Zero Budget Natural Farming means 100% Organic farming from Gaia’s Gomutra (Urine) and Gomaya (Dung). Gaia means Bhartiya Govansh. WHY WAS INDIAN (OR VEDIC) CIVILIZATION WAS “PROSPEROUS ” ABUNDANT NATION? This was because India had topsoil for at least 50 centuries (which means it can grow and is suitable for all types of the crop on this land) and … Read more